Japan's Shinryo Corporation to Acquire GMP Technical Solutions

Shinryo Corporation, a $1.7 billion Japanese HVAC giant, will acquire an 85% stake in India's GMP Technical Solutions Pvt Ltd, a leading manufacturer of cleanroom partitions. The deal, valued at Rs 185 crore, marks Shinryo's expansion into the Indian market. GMP, owned by Vascon Engineers Limited, specializes in cleanroom, modular partition, and HVAC solutions for the pharmaceutical and semiconductor sectors. This acquisition is Shinryo's latest move following its purchase of Suvidha Engineers India in 2018, highlighting its commitment to growing its presence in India’s HVAC industry.
